Ok, I am writing this fast and to the point--Tom Cruise is with Cameron Diaz; he never loved her-- then he meets Penelope Cruz, after the car accident with Cameron Diaz, Cameron Diaz dies, and Tom Cruise's face is basically deformed. Up until after the club with Penelope Cruz and Tom's friend (when Tom wears a mask) and after all three go home, he goes home and signs up for LE on the internet. He leaves his father's friend in charge of his percentage to the company-- he later commits suicide and LE takes over-- after that, "it's all a dream in his LE state." He never murdered Sophia (Penelope Cruz), nor went to jail, etc; that was all a mistake, he began having nightmares in his LE state. He's actually been in LE for 150 years, which means that Sophia and probably all of the people he knew are dead now. And at the end, when he wakes up (when his eye opens), when the lady says, "Open your eyes" is a nurse working in the LE organization telling him to "open your eyes," as he decided to come back after talking to the tech support Sophia (Penelope Cruz) truly loved him but Tom barely knew her, unfortunately, although he loved her too (or realized she was for him)-- and, yes, his face changed to normal when he sees Sophia again at the end, as he is creating his reality in his dream state-- but, she never cared that his face was damaged in real life, before he signed to LE His face will be cured, but as the Tech support guy told him, everything will be all different. As Lexx said, it will all make sense after he talks to the tech support guy at the end. Due to his depression, David sought the services of Life Extension, wishing to start the Lucid Dream the morning after the drunken incident, and to live under the "vanilla sky" his mother always talked about-- They, the LE organization, erased his memory where he committed suicide and erased that he chose to sign up for LE. quote: He was placed in the cryogenic system, where he has been for the past 150 years. While David was experiencing the Lucid Dream, a malfunction of the system caused the dream to become a nightmare, merging Sofia and Julianna's personas and creating people, such as Dr. McCabe, out of his past memories. At the roof of the building, the man offers David a choice, to either be reinserted into the corrected Lucid Dream as to be together with Sofia forever, or to opt to wake up though this requires a leap of faith off the building. David opts to be awakened so that he can live a real life, and he takes a few last moments to say goodbye to the Dream versions of Sofia and Brian, then jumps off the building, his memories flashing through his eyes as he falls. Just as he hits the ground, a voice tells David to wake up, the film briefly focuses on his closed eye opening onto the real world.
